Balbalan, Kalinga – The Municipality of Balbalan has once again been recognized for its sound financial management after earning the 2025 Good Financial Housekeeping (GFH) Passer Citation, marking its fifth consecutive year of receiving the prestigious recognition.


The Good Financial Housekeeping award is one of the highest recognitions given to local government units that demonstrate compliance with government accounting and auditing standards, as well as transparency and accountability in the management of public funds.


Balbalan has consistently received the GFH citation since 2021, reflecting the municipality's sustained commitment to responsible fiscal governance.


Mayor Almar Malannag said the recognition is a testament to the collective efforts of local officials, department heads, and municipal employees in maintaining high standards of public service.


“With this recognition, it reflects the dedication of our local government officials and department heads with all the employees ta kayat mi amin nga i-uphold ken i-sustain tayo iti highest standards of transparency, accountability, ken responsible nga panag-manage iti public funds idiay Balbalan,” he said.


Malannag emphasized that public funds must be managed responsibly and translated into programs, projects, and services that directly benefit the people.


The mayor also expressed hope that the latest recognition would inspire local government workers to continue serving with integrity and dedication.


“May this milestone continue to inspire excellence, integrity, and accountability among all the iBalbalans. Itul-tuloy tayo latta iti agtrabaho para kadagiti kakailyan tapnu iti kasta ket agtul-tuloy latta nga agprogresso iti ili tayo nga Balbalan,” he added.
